M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 一般算法 > MATLAB克里金插值球状模型半变异函数拟合分析系统

MATLAB克里金插值球状模型半变异函数拟合分析系统

资 源 简 介

本MATLAB项目实现了基于普通克里金的空间插值算法,采用球状模型拟合半变异函数,完成二维空间数据的插值预测与精度评估。系统提供了可靠的误差分析功能,适用于地理信息处理与环境建模研究。

详 情 说 明

克里金插值球状模型半变异函数拟合与分析系统

项目介绍

本项目实现了一个基于普通克里金(Ordinary Kriging)的空间插值计算系统,专门采用球状模型(Spherical Model)进行半变异函数拟合。系统能够对二维空间坐标点上的属性值进行插值预测,通过自动优化半变异函数参数,生成高精度的插值曲面,并提供完整的可视化分析和精度评估。

功能特性

  • 空间数据预处理:自动处理输入的坐标数据和属性值,确保数据格式合规
  • 半变异函数计算:基于样本点空间分布计算经验半变异函数
  • 球状模型参数优化:采用优化算法自动拟合最优的基台值、变程和块金值
  • 克里金插值计算:构建克里金方程组,求解权重矩阵,实现空间插值预测
  • 精度评估:提供插值方差估计,量化预测结果的可靠性
  • 可视化分析:生成半变异函数拟合图和插值曲面图,直观展示分析结果
  • 参数报告:输出详细的拟合参数和拟合优度指标

使用方法

  1. 准备输入数据
- 准备n×2的空间坐标矩阵,包含样本点的x、y坐标 - 准备n×1的属性值向量,对应各坐标点的观测值 - 准备m×2的待预测点坐标矩阵 - (可选)设置球状模型的初始参数

  1. 运行系统
- 执行主程序文件启动插值分析流程

  1. 获取输出结果
- 得到m×1的插值预测值向量 - 获得m×1的插值方差向量 - 查看半变异函数拟合效果图 - 分析插值曲面可视化结果 - 查阅拟合参数报告

系统要求

  • MATLAB R2018b或更高版本
  • 优化工具箱(用于参数拟合)
  • 统计和机器学习工具箱(可选,用于高级分析)

文件说明

主程序文件整合了系统的所有核心功能,包括数据输入与预处理、半变异函数的计算与球状模型拟合、克里金方程组的构建与求解、插值预测执行、结果精度评估以及各类可视化图形的生成。该文件通过协调各功能模块的工作流程,实现了从原始数据到最终插值分析结果的全自动化处理。